TITLE: Production Coordinator

DEPARTMENT: Donor Recruitment

Join our team of heroes!

Reporting to the Donor Recruitment Operations Manager, this position is responsible for supporting donor and donor group programs to ensure the delivery of positive donor experiences. Acting in a supportive role, the Production Coordinator will ensure departmental commitments are delivered successfully.

In this role, youll:

  • Support departmental projects as directed by Donor Recruitment Management. Projects include but are not limited to High School Workshop, Blood Center tours, and CP conferences.
  • Support Donor Recruitment operations to enhance internal and external customer service experiences.
  • Assist with promotional donor incentives including the distribution and fulfillment of promotional items.
  • Reconcile returned incentive items and mail any run-out items to donors promptly to reduce turnaround time for runouts.
  • Perform Donor Recruitment Support activities including but not limited to producing, packing, shipping print materials, and answering phones.
  • Ensures promotional and educational materials are continuously updated for new, accurate, and relevant content.
  • Responsible for tracking and reconciliation of departmental assets and devices.
  • Adhere to department guidelines, rules, regulations, and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s).
  • Master comprehensive understanding of Blood Center programs to answer donor questions with all donor groups and provide the necessary information.
  • Performs finger pricks for ABO Blood Typing at High School events.
  • Act as backup to the Support Team when needed.

We need someone who has:

Associate degree or certificate from an accredited technical school in a related field; minimum of one year experience in administrative or production support, or equivalent combination of education and experience.
